Explore the diverse rituals surrounding death through the experiences of members of Wellington’s Assyrian, Chinese, Colombian, Hindu, Jewish, Mexican and Muslim communities. Find out about the changes these groups have made since arriving in New Zealand, and about other recent developments in funeral and mourning practices.
